ManTech is seeking a motivated, career and customer-oriented Cyber Security Analyst to join our team in the Herndon, VA to begin an exciting and rewarding career within ManTech. Several levels available based on experience and qualifications. Responsibilities include, but not limited to: * Analysts work together as a team to develop skills, sources, and methods to provide the best possible cyber defense capability to protect the Sponsors IT assets from all manner of cyber threats, attacks, and exploitation. * Analysts provide analysis and recommendations on all cyber defense issues. The contractor shall conduct independent research on various cyber security technologies and provide analysis to the above forums via concise written reports, briefings, and verbal presentations. * The analyst shall provide technical risk analysis of the various technologies based on the cyber security architecture, develop a cyber-security roadmap, and prepare issue-based technical and risk analysis resulting from the Infosec Program Council (IPC) and OCS Senior Leadership. * The analyst shall draft and maintain white papers, briefings, and other technical documents in support of OCS's Cyber Security strategic vision. * The analyst shall support cyber security strategic planning and development across Agency systems. * The analyst shall create a library of documents outlining cyber security principles, requirements, and standards. * The analyst shall understand foundational cyber security principles, identify project impacting, and engineering elements that define overall enterprise and cyber security requirements. * The analyst shall create and maintain a discussion board in Web form for cyber security topics of importance to CIA technology organizations. * The analyst shall create and maintain a program to formalize vendor relationships and related vendor comparisons, including risk-based scoring to determine the most secure solutions.
